The Music on Main and the PuSh Festival present a Roomful of Teeth on January 25th and 26th. A Roomful of Teeth is a Grammy award-winning vocal group. The group was founded in 2009 by director Brad Wells. The ensemble consists of eight classically trained vocalists dedicated to re-imagining singing in the 21st century. Through study with masters from singing traditions the world over, they continually expand their vocabulary and singing techniques by commissioning and creating new works. This is their first appearance in Vancouver. If you wish to listen to their sound, you can check them out on Bandcamp.com. The event takes place at The Fox Cabaret, 2321 Main Street and kicks off at 8:00 pm both evenings. Tickets are available from Tickets Tonight.
